SpreadJS 14
GC.Spread.Sheets.FloatingObjects Namespace / FloatingObject type / endColumn Method
The end column index of the floating object position.
In This Topic
    endColumn Method
    In This Topic
    Gets or sets the end column index of the floating object position.
    Syntax
    var instance = new GC.Spread.Sheets.FloatingObjects.FloatingObject(name, x, y, width, height);
    var returnValue; // Type: any
    returnValue = instance.endColumn(value);
    function endColumn( 
       value : number
    ) : any;

    Parameters

    value
    The end column index of the floating object position.

    Return Value

    If no value is set, returns the end column index of the floating object position; otherwise, returns the floating object.
    Example
    This example creates a floating object.
    var customFloatingObject = new GC.Spread.Sheets.FloatingObjects.FloatingObject("f1", 10, 10, 60, 64);
    var btn = document.createElement('button');
    btn.style.width = "60px";
    btn.style.height = "30px";
    btn.innerText = "button";
    customFloatingObject.content(btn);
    activeSheet.floatingObjects.add(customFloatingObject);
    //takes effect when added into the sheet.
    customFloatingObject.startRow(2);
    customFloatingObject.startColumn(2);
    customFloatingObject.startRowOffset(10);
    customFloatingObject.startColumnOffset(10);
    customFloatingObject.endRow(7);
    customFloatingObject.endColumn(5);
    customFloatingObject.endRowOffset(10);
    customFloatingObject.endColumnOffset(10);
    Remarks
    This method only takes effect after the floating object has been added to the sheet.
    See Also